Strategic insight: the Brisbane CBD cleaning services market

This market rewards premium, convenience-led pricing rather than discount volume. Weekly household income of $1,857 sits well above typical Brisbane suburbs, but CBD living means most clients are renters and apartment dwellers with little time and less inclination to negotiate. An 8.13% unemployment rate suggests a two-speed customer base: professionals paying for recurring office and bond-clean contracts, and a smaller segment chasing one-off cut-price jobs. Operators who anchor on subscription-style residential and commercial work, not casual single jobs, capture the paying majority here.

Opening a cleaning business in Brisbane CBD: common questions

how many cleaning businesses are there in Brisbane CBD

Nine cleaning operators run in Brisbane CBD. Density is moderate — effective density, which adjusts for competitor quality, is only 21 out of 100, so the market isn't as squeezed as the headcount suggests. Roughly two-thirds carry limited public review history, leaving room for a new operator with a clear niche.

is Brisbane CBD a good place to start a cleaning business

Brisbane CBD scores 53 out of 100 on the Strategique Score, rated Strong, backed by a Market Opportunity score of 67. That combination — solid demand against only moderate Competitor Strength of 36 — makes it a sound location, provided the business avoids going head-to-head with the established residential leader.

how strong is the cleaning competition in Brisbane CBD

Competitor Strength sits at 36 out of 100, a middling field. Calibre Cleaning - House Cleaning Brisbane leads on volume with 340 reviews at 4.3 stars. KL Cleaning (5 stars, 49 reviews) and Clean Group - Commercial Cleaning and Office Cleaning Brisbane (5 stars, 31 reviews) rate higher but haven't built matching scale yet.

what does the Brisbane CBD population mean for cleaning business earnings

Weekly household income in the catchment is $1,857, well above the national median, but unemployment runs at 8.13% across a small, dense population of 13,310, mostly renters and office workers. Spending favours recurring contracts over one-off jobs, since time-poor CBD clients pay for reliability, not the cheapest quote.

how do you open a cleaning business in Brisbane CBD

Pick a lane before entering. Commercial and office cleaning has only one strong 5-star competitor, Clean Group, with 31 reviews, unlike the crowded residential segment led by Calibre. Build review volume fast through office building managers and body corporates in the CBD tower stock, and price around recurring contracts rather than single cleans.
